COMMUNITY OPENING & PRESENTATION The overall presentation of the community, including monumentation, landscaping, and site cleanliness, is a significant factor when marketing and selling a new home community. The presentation of our communities demonstrates Century’s commitment to quality. LD teams are required to keep their job sites clean and clear of trash, debris, excess materials, weeds, and unnecessary stockpiles. LD teams must maintain site cleanliness, including streets, lots, detention basins, amenities, and parkways. We also need to hold our Trade Partners responsible for cleaning up after they finish their work for a given day. VERTICAL CONSTRUCTION Vertical construction teams are responsible for managing and maintaining finished lots once they have been turned over to them. Homebuilding teams shall maintain an orderly, clean, safe, and compliant jobsite per the construction playbook. Any remediation and repair work necessary due to impacts of vertical vendors after the substantial completion transition should be charged to the appropriate vendor and tracked under the applicable vertical home cost code (not within any LD cost code). SALES The division sales should coordinate or help coordinate production phasing, model location, floor plan offerings, and the building program strategy. LD Professionals will communicate and provide necessary background files concurrent with substantial completion and the initiation of sales team activities. LD needs to coordinate well in advance the timing and expectation for community monumentation, landscaping, and amenity installation. HOA Community maintenance of common areas, landscape, and amenity improvements will transition to the HOA team concurrent with its associated substantial completion process. LD Professionals will communicate and provide as-built information of the landscape plans and associated irrigation systems within the project files to the associate team member responsible for HOA setup and coordination. Team members should ensure that there are no maintenance gaps between the delivery and installation of the LD contractors and the subsequent full-time maintenance vendors. MARKETING The national and division marketing teams will have been included in previous coordination with respect to community branding, signage, monumentation, and sales material development. LD Professionals will communicate and provide necessary background files concurrent with substantial completion milestones as they occur and schedule updates as needed. Marketing team members should only communicate high-level target date goals and not pass any specific dates along as public information.
